Last Channel Databa
se
In order to select the new channel number from
LAST
channels database make a counter
clockwise turn on the “ROTARY ENCODER“. The channel number is now highlighted and one of
the nine last used channels is selectable by turning the “ROTARY ENCODER“, either clockwise or
counter clockwise. The mode of channel number selection can be left manually by repeated
pressing of the “ROTARY ENCODER“, or the mode is left automatically after a 5 seconds timeout.
When leaving the
LAST
channels database and the last shown frequency is not stored in one of
the
USER
cannels database, “CH--”will appear on the display.
Accessing the last channels database will be possible if “STORE LAST CHANNEL” is selected on
MEMORY OPTIONS page in the installation setup, otherwise the recently stored VHF frequencies
will not be available.

3.5.4
Scan Mode
In all frequency selection modes;
1. A long press of “↕/SCN” key activates the scan function and changes to STANDARD
MODE if activated from CHANNEL or DIRECT TUNE mode.
2. A short push on the “MDE” key or a long press on “SCN” key terminates scan function.
After leaving scan function, the device will remain in standard mode (chapter 3.5.1).
In scan mode the display shows both the active frequency on the top line and the preset frequency
on the bottom line. The SCAN sign in the display indicates that scan function is active.
If both the active frequency and preset frequency simultaneously detect a signal, the active
frequency takes priority. The preset frequency then inverts and blinks. The arrow sign “►” in front
of the active frequency indicates that this frequency is audible. The figure below shows a sample.
If selected in the installation setup an audio notification “beep” tone becomes audible in addition to
the blinking preset frequency to indicate the presence of an RX signal on the preset frequency.
Reception on Preset Frequency in Scan Mode
If the preset frequency detects a signal while no signal is present on the active frequency, the
transceiver automatically switches over to the preset frequency.
The arrow sign now appears in front of the preset frequency and the signal is audible. The picture
